DTC P0421: Warm Up Catalyst Efficiency Below Threshold (cylinder 1, 4)
.
TECHNICAL DESCRIPTION
• The signal from the rear heated oxygen sensor
differs from the front heated oxygen sensor. That
is because the catalytic converter purifies
exhaust gas. When the catalytic converter has
deteriorated, the signal from the front heated oxy-
gen sensor becomes similar to the rear heated
oxygen sensor.
• The PCM compares the output of the front and
rear heated oxygen sensor signals.
.
DESCRIPTIONS OF MONITOR METHODS
Front and rear heated oxygen sensor rich/lean
switching frequencies are nearly equal.

Check Conditions
• Engine speed is lower than 3,000 r/min.
• Accelerator pedal is open.
• Mass airflow is between 14 and 45 g/sec.
• More than 3 seconds have elapsed after the
above-mentioned three conditions have been
met.
• Intake air temperature is higher than −10°C
(14
°F).
• Barometric pressure is higher than 76 kPa (22.4
in.Hg).
• Under the closed loop air/fuel ratio control.
• Vehicle speed is 1.5 km/h (1.0 mph) or more.
• The PCM monitors for this condition for 5 cycles
of 10 seconds each during the drive cycle.
• Short-term fuel trim is higher than −25 percent
and lower than +25 percent.
• The cumulative mass airflow is higher than 1,638
g.
Judgment Criteria
• The frequency ratio of cylinder 1, 4 heated oxy-
gen sensor (rear) and cylinder 1, 4 heated oxy-
gen sensor (front) is more than 0.7. <Federal>
or
• The frequency ratio of cylinder 1, 4 heated oxy-
gen sensor (rear) and cylinder 1, 4 heated oxy-
gen sensor (front) is more than 0.6. <California>

TROUBLESHOOTING HINTS (The most
likely causes for this code to be set are:)
• Cylinder 1, 4 side catalytic converter deteriorated.
• Cylinder 1, 4 heated oxygen sensor failed.
• Exhaust leak.
• PCM failed.
DIAGNOSIS
Required Special Tools:
• MB991958: Scan tool (MUT-III Sub Assembly)
• MB991824: V.C.I.
• MB991827: USB Cable
• MB991910: Main Harness A
STEP 1. Check for exhaust leak.
Q: Are there any abnormalities?
YES : Repair it. Then go to Step 7.
NO : Go to Step 2.

STEP 2. Using scan tool MB991958, check data list item 69:
Cylinder 1, 4 Heated Oxygen Sensor (rear).
CAUTION
To prevent damage to scan tool MB991958, always turn the
ignition switch to the "LOCK" (OFF) position before con-
necting or disconnecting scan tool MB991958.
(1) Connect scan tool MB991958 to the data link connector.
(2) Start the engine and run at idle.
(3) Set scan tool MB991958 to the data reading mode for item
69, Cylinder 1, 4 Heated Oxygen Sensor (rear).
• Warming up the engine. When the engine is revved, the
output voltage should repeat 0 volt and 0.6 to 1.0 volt
alternately.
(4) Turn the ignition switch to the "LOCK" (OFF) position.
Q: Is the sensor operating properly?
YES : Go to Step 3.

STEP 4. Using scan tool MB991958, check data list item 39:
Cylinder 1, 4 Heated Oxygen Sensor (front).
(1) Start the engine and run at idle.
(2) Set scan tool MB991958 to the data reading mode for item
39, Cylinder 1, 4 Heated Oxygen Sensor (front).
(3) Keep the engine speed at 2,000 r/min.
• 0 − 0.4 and 0.6 − 1.0 volt should alternate 15 times or
more within 10 seconds.
(4) Turn the ignition switch to the "LOCK" (OFF) position.
Q: Is the sensor operating properly?
YES : Go to Step 5.
NO : Replace the cylinder 1, 4 heated oxygen sensor
(front). Then go to Step 7.
